Analysis
Switzerland recorded 277 for inbound internationally mobile students from asia: students from in 2024. That is the highest value across all 26 years on record.
Compared with earlier readings it is up 4.9% on the previous year and up 93.7% over ten years.
Over the whole period, inbound internationally mobile students from asia: students from in Switzerland peaked at 277 in 2024 and was at its lowest, 9, in 2000.
Switzerland ranks 8th of 121 countries on this measure, in the top 10%.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.
Inbound internationally mobile students from Asia: Students from in Switzerland, year by year
| Year | Value | Change |
|---|---|---|
| 1999 | 10 | — |
| 2000 | 9 | -10.0% |
| 2001 | 12 | +33.3% |
| 2002 | 17 | +41.7% |
| 2003 | 18 | +5.9% |
| 2004 | 20 | +11.1% |
| 2005 | 17 | -15.0% |
| 2006 | 34 | +100.0% |
| 2007 | 39 | +14.7% |
| 2008 | 65 | +66.7% |
| 2009 | 84 | +29.2% |
| 2010 | 101 | +20.2% |
| 2011 | 122 | +20.8% |
| 2012 | 123 | +0.8% |
| 2013 | 135 | +9.8% |
| 2014 | 143 | +5.9% |
| 2015 | 145 | +1.4% |
| 2016 | 147 | +1.4% |
| 2017 | 162 | +10.2% |
| 2018 | 180 | +11.1% |
| 2019 | 185 | +2.8% |
| 2020 | 201 | +8.6% |
| 2021 | 209 | +4.0% |
| 2022 | 226 | +8.1% |
| 2023 | 264 | +16.8% |
| 2024 | 277 | +4.9% |
